LiteratureRe: Things Fall Apart VS Arrow Of God (pics) by DIKEnaWAR: 3:04am On May 06, 2016
Olakunle007:
Please, pardon me if my reply is not explanatory enough. I read the book just once and the very days i read it is something I can't remember. Just to tell you how far it's. Know it well the novel is a tragedy in which we learn to understand what kills great men. Ezeulu, you mentioned is a great man, no doubt. But I think his ultimate reason for not eating those yams is to punish the people. I can remember I read it the elders saying they will take the punishment on their heads. Ezeulu only used the god as a coverup. When the people realize their yam will perish make them to follow the new religion, which is Christianity. I would have given a good picture of the whole thing but I have forgotten most characters and events in the book. To worsen the matter, a friend of mine had taken it away.
Worthy observation, but the question is; is Ezeulu supposed to eat more than one sacred yam in one moon? Wouldn't the action have set him against his god who had assured him of fighting the batte as his own, while he was in Okperi?

Those yams marked the moon(months) in a year and for Ezeulu to eat them would amount to arrogating to himself the powers of a god, who decides what moon and time it was in a year(don't forget planting season and all revolve round this). Do you think Nwaka, Eze Idemili and other critics would have spared Ezulu if he had eaten more than one yam?

Though Achebe gave Ezeulu no chances, Ulu could be likened to the proverbial lizard that ruined his mother's funeral. Ulu was like the dog that wanted to answer two masters at the same time and broke his jaw in the process. Ulu gave Idemili and Ogwugwu the land and mat with which they buried it, because in trying to hurt its priest, it shot itself on the foot. It chose a bad time to punish its priest, for whatever infraction.
